摘要
Recent results obtained about the mechanisms underlying anisotropic plasma etching as used for the transfer of patterns in very large scale integrated circuit technology are reviewed. Quantitative results on physical sputtering yields resulting from bombardment of elementary targets with inert atomic ions have been obtained down to the range of ion energies of interest in plasma etching, i. e. typically down to about 100 eV. It appears that the Sigmund model, originally expected to be valid only to about 1 keV, also quantitatively describes the results down to 100 eV.
